    Question Bilstein B8 Struts + Lowering Springs on Non S-Line A4 2018

    Guest-only advertisement. Register or Log In now!
    Hi,

    I'm looking to purchase new Bilstein B8 struts and lowering springs for my non s-line A4 (factory base suspension is ~3" fender to wheel).

    I would like to lower the car only for aesthetic reasons, but also daily it during the winters. I've also looked into coilovers, but I don't want to adjust the height for winter / summer season (and also pay for alignment).

    I have looked into 034 Motorsport Dynamic Springs (2" drop), Eibach Sportline (1.8" & 1.6" drop), H&R (1.6" drop) & eMMOTION (1.6" drop). Can anyone chime in some of their experiences? Digging though the forums, it seems like 034 & eMMOTION are well-regarded, but any comments would be helpful.

    I installed B8 struts and OEM sport springs on my car. My A4 is a sline, but did not have the sport package.

    It's a bit over dampened, but still a nice ride. PXL_20220811_182729684.jpgPXL_20220710_214157225.jpg
